test/layouts/test_json.rb in logging-1.8.2 vs test/layouts/test_json.rb in logging-2.0.0
- old
+ new
@@ -96,9 +96,12 @@
assert_equal %Q[{"message":"log message"}\n], @layout.format(event)
@layout.items = %w[method]
assert_equal %Q[{"method":"method_name"}\n], @layout.format(event)
+ @layout.items = %w[hostname]
+ assert_equal %Q[{"hostname":"#{Socket.gethostname}"}\n], @layout.format(event)
+
@layout.items = %w[pid]
assert_match %r/\A\{"pid":\d+\}\n\z/, @layout.format(event)
@layout.items = %w[millis]
assert_match %r/\A\{"millis":\d+\}\n\z/, @layout.format(event)